## Key Ceremony Checklist — Item 7: Nightly Reindex Signer

Before sealing the envelope, confirm the Burrowlight nightly search reindex job can still sign its manifests with the new key. Run the dry-run reindex against the staging index and eyeball the checksums — future you will thank you. Then record, for the sealed packet, the recovery passphrase below.

vault phrase of tajeg-tageg = pelix-druix-holius-briael-zorwyn-frawyn-fraox-norok-drueth-aldiel

Finance Review — Q3 Budget Request, Varrelux Systems

The Q3 ask from the Talmere region team totals 410k, up 12% on last cycle. Headcount additions: two field reps, one analyst. Travel line is inflated; we trimmed it 15%. Demo-unit spend approved as submitted. Marketing co-funding for the Brackwell launch deferred pending pipeline proof. Net approved: 362k. Sales leads should align territory targets to this figure by Friday. Overruns require sign-off from Dena Holcroft. Context on why we're holding the line follows below.

internal memo for kagap-hahig: Project Aldeth slips by six weeks because of the staffing delay.

Handover — Vexler partner SFTP drop

Ownership moves to you today. Drop runs hourly from Vexler's end into the intake bucket via the relay host. Watch for zero-byte files; their exporter flakes on Mondays. Creds live in the ops vault, path noted in the runbook. Vault auto-seals after 48h idle. Support escalations go to the on-call rotation, not me. If the vault is sealed when you need it, unseal with the recovery passphrase below.

recovery phrase for tadug-fafof: zorwyn-kasion